Midwest Dental, supported by Smile Brands, is seeking a dependable and adaptable
Traveling Periodontal Dental Assistant
to join our growing team. This is a unique opportunity for a motivated dental assistant who enjoys variety, teamwork, and travel within a clinical setting.
Position Overview
In this role, you will primarily travel with a periodontist for approximately
two weeks per month , typically on an every‑other‑week schedule, with the potential to expand to a third week in the future. During alternating weeks, you will support other offices in the region, assisting general dentists and hygienists as needed.
This position requires strong organizational skills, flexibility, and comfort with a fast‑paced, mobile work environment.
Schedule (days/hours)
Monday‑Thurs 7:45‑5, Friday 7:45‑4
Responsibilities
Travel with the periodontist to assigned office locations (approximately 2 weeks per month)
Set up, transport, and maintain dental instruments and clinical supplies
Load and unload instruments and equipment at each location efficiently and safely
Assist periodontist chairside during periodontal procedures
Support general dentists and hygienists during non-periodontal weeks
Ensure all instruments and equipment are properly sterilized, organized, and accounted for
Maintain high standards of infection control and clinical readiness across all locations
Collaborate with multiple teams across different office environments
Qualifications
Meet all state specific dental assistant credentialing requirements for the duties assigned in the state of employment
Current CPR/BLS certification (or ability to obtain before start date)
Strong communication and commitment to excellent patient care
